Anodizing and polishing combined for superior CNC part finishes

Pairing anodizing with polishing upgrades both appearance and longevity for precision-manufactured parts

The anodizing process adds a durable oxide coating and color potential; polishing delivers a smooth, attractive final surface

These complementary steps yield greater wear resilience, environmental defense, and a finish spectrum from satin to mirror

Tailored finishing processes to optimize operational performance

Maximizing mechanical performance commonly requires precise surface treatments to manage friction and enhance wear resistance

  • Hardening processes raise the surface hardness of parts to reduce wear and prolong lifespan
  • Selecting ceramic, nitride, or carbon coatings provides enhanced corrosion resistance and long-lasting surface protection

Choosing the optimal treatment depends on operating conditions and application specifics, requiring thorough evaluation
